What Is Formaldehyde?
Formaldehyde is a colourless, flammable gas with a strong and sharp odour, commonly described as smelling like pickles or nail polish remover. It belongs to a family of chemicals known as volatile organic compounds (VOCs), meaning it exists as a gas at room temperature and can be inhaled without any visible warning sign. While formaldehyde is found naturally in small quantities in the environment and even produced by the human body as part of normal metabolism, the concentrations found indoors, particularly in newly built or recently renovated homes, are a very different matter. It is widely used across industrial and consumer products as a preservative, adhesive, and binder, which is exactly what makes it so difficult to avoid.
Where Does Formaldehyde Come From in Your Home?
The sources of formaldehyde in a typical Singapore home are more numerous than most people realise. The most significant contributors are pressed-wood products, which rely on urea-formaldehyde resins as the bonding agent that holds the material together. This is not a trace ingredient; it is a core structural component that continues releasing gas over time, a process known as off-gassing.
Common household sources include:
- Pressed-wood furniture and cabinets: Particleboard, MDF (medium-density fibreboard), and plywood used in wardrobes, kitchen cabinets, shelving, and built-in furniture are among the highest-emitting sources. MDF in particular contains a higher resin-to-wood ratio than other pressed-wood products, making it the most significant emitter.
- Laminate and vinyl flooring: The adhesives used to install laminate and vinyl flooring contain formaldehyde compounds that release gas, especially during the first months after installation.
- Paints and varnishes: Many paints historically used formaldehyde as a preservative or stabiliser. While Singapore has tightened regulations on this (more on that below), older paint stocks and improperly labelled imports can still be a concern.
- Carpets and upholstery: New carpets and rugs are often treated with stain-resistant chemicals that include formaldehyde, which off-gas gradually over time.
- Curtains and fabric treatments: Some textiles, particularly those treated for wrinkle resistance or flame retardancy, contain formaldehyde-releasing agents.
- Household cleaning products: Certain disinfectants, detergents, and even some cosmetics contain formaldehyde or formaldehyde-releasing preservatives as part of their formulation.
What makes renovation periods especially hazardous is that multiple sources are often introduced simultaneously. Fresh MDF carpentry, new laminates, new furniture, and newly applied paint can all off-gas at the same time, compounding the concentration in the air significantly. Why Singapore Homes Face a Higher Risk
Singapore’s tropical climate creates conditions that actively accelerate formaldehyde off-gassing. Formaldehyde is a volatile organic compound that releases more readily at higher temperatures and humidity levels, which are exactly the conditions found year-round in Singapore. When the temperature rises, the chemical bonds in resin-based materials weaken, releasing more gas into the surrounding air.
The situation is further complicated by how most Singaporeans manage their indoor climate. Homes and offices are typically sealed for air conditioning during the hottest parts of the day, which prevents ventilation and allows formaldehyde levels to accumulate indoors. In a naturally ventilated home, off-gassed chemicals would gradually dissipate. In a well-sealed, air-conditioned flat, they concentrate. This combination of high emission rates from materials and low natural ventilation makes Singapore homes particularly susceptible to elevated formaldehyde exposure, especially during and immediately after renovations.
Health Risks of Formaldehyde Exposure
The health effects of formaldehyde depend on the concentration of the gas in the air and the duration of exposure. It is useful to understand both the short-term and long-term picture, because they affect the body in different ways and call for different responses.
Short-Term Exposure
At elevated concentrations, formaldehyde causes immediate irritation that most people mistake for a cold, allergies, or simply the result of moving into a new home. Symptoms typically include watery or burning eyes, a runny nose, throat irritation, coughing, wheezing, headaches, and in some cases nausea or skin irritation. These symptoms usually begin when formaldehyde levels climb above 0.1 parts per million. The frustrating reality is that many households dismiss these warning signs as temporary, when in fact they are the body’s direct response to chemical exposure.
Long-Term Exposure
Prolonged exposure to formaldehyde carries far more serious consequences. The World Health Organisation (WHO) classifies formaldehyde as a Group 1 human carcinogen, placing it in the same category as tobacco smoke and asbestos. Long-term exposure at even moderate indoor levels has been linked to increased risk of nasopharyngeal cancer, leukaemia, and chronic respiratory conditions. Once a person becomes sensitised to formaldehyde, even small concentrations can trigger reactions. Children, elderly residents, and anyone with asthma, allergies, or existing respiratory conditions are especially vulnerable, as they often spend the most time indoors and are physiologically more sensitive to chemical exposure.

Singapore’s Formaldehyde Safety Standards
Singapore has established clear regulatory standards to govern safe formaldehyde levels indoors. The local Code of Practice for Indoor Air Quality (SS 554) sets the acceptable formaldehyde concentration in air-conditioned environments at 0.08 parts per million (ppm), a threshold aligned with international guidance from the WHO. Exceeding this limit is associated with the onset of health symptoms, particularly for sensitive individuals.
On the product side, Singapore’s National Environment Agency (NEA) took a significant step by banning the addition of formaldehyde in interior paints from 1 January 2026. Under the Environmental Protection and Management Act, companies found selling interior paints with formaldehyde levels at or above 0.01% by weight face fines of up to $50,000 or imprisonment. This is a meaningful public health measure, though it is worth noting that paint is only one part of the problem. The larger and longer-lasting sources of formaldehyde in most homes remain composite wood products such as wardrobes, kitchen cabinets, and built-in shelving, which use formaldehyde-based resins as their primary bonding agent and continue emitting gas for months or even years after installation.
Homeowners looking to make informed choices when purchasing materials should look for products certified under the Singapore Green Labelling Scheme (SGLS) or those carrying E0 certification, which guarantees extremely low or non-detectable formaldehyde emissions.
Signs You May Be Exposed to Formaldehyde
Recognising potential formaldehyde exposure early can prevent health issues from becoming serious. Here are the key warning signs to watch for, particularly after a move-in, renovation, or the arrival of new furniture:
- A persistent chemical smell: A sharp, sour, or acrid odour that lingers even after airing out the room, especially near new cabinets, wardrobes, or floors.
- Eye and throat irritation: Burning or watery eyes, a scratchy throat, or a persistent cough that seems to worsen when you are at home but improves when you leave.
- Unexplained headaches: Recurring headaches that correlate with time spent indoors, particularly in newly renovated or furnished rooms.
- Worsening allergy or asthma symptoms: If existing conditions appear to flare up in the home without a clear trigger, elevated VOC levels including formaldehyde may be a contributing factor.
- Skin irritation: Unexplained rashes or itching, especially after direct contact with new textiles, upholstery, or carpets.
It is worth noting that some formaldehyde variants produce minimal odour despite reaching dangerous concentrations, so a lack of noticeable smell does not confirm that levels are safe. If you are in any doubt, particularly after a renovation or move-in, professional air quality testing provides reliable answers.
How to Reduce Formaldehyde in Your Home
The good news is that there are practical, actionable steps you can take to reduce formaldehyde levels in your living environment. A layered approach, combining better material choices, improved ventilation, and regular cleaning, is the most effective strategy.
1. Ventilate Consistently
Ventilation is the single most important step in reducing indoor formaldehyde concentrations. Opening windows daily, particularly in the morning and evening, allows fresh air to circulate and dilutes the build-up of off-gassed chemicals. Exhaust fans in kitchens and bathrooms also help push stale, contaminated air outside rather than recirculating it. In the first weeks after a renovation or major furniture delivery, ventilating the space as often as possible is especially important, as off-gassing rates are highest immediately after installation and new materials are introduced.
2. Use Air Purifiers with Activated Carbon Filters
Standard HEPA filters are effective at capturing dust and allergens but are not designed to remove gases like formaldehyde. For VOC and formaldehyde removal, you need an air purifier equipped with activated carbon filters, which work by adsorbing chemical molecules from the air. Replace the filters regularly, as saturated filters lose their effectiveness and can even release absorbed pollutants back into the air. Look for units that specifically list VOC or formaldehyde removal on their specification sheets for the best results.
3. Choose Low-Emission Materials
When planning a renovation or purchasing furniture, the choices you make upfront have the most lasting impact on your indoor air quality. Opt for products certified under the Singapore Green Labelling Scheme or those with E0 or E1 emission ratings. Solid wood, natural stone, and formaldehyde-free alternatives to MDF can significantly reduce the total emission load in your home. Asking your ID or contractor about the formaldehyde emission grade of the materials they plan to use is a straightforward conversation that can protect your household for years.
4. Seal Exposed Wood Surfaces
If you already have pressed-wood furniture or cabinetry that is emitting formaldehyde, sealing the exposed surfaces can meaningfully reduce further off-gassing. Low-VOC paints, varnishes, or purpose-made sealants create a physical barrier over the surface, slowing the rate at which the resin releases gas into the air. This is a practical interim measure while you plan longer-term replacements or allow existing materials to off-gas naturally over time.
5. Add Air-Purifying Plants
Certain houseplants have a well-documented ability to absorb VOCs from the surrounding air. Spider plants, Boston ferns, golden pothos, peace lilies, and aloe vera are among the most effective options for absorbing formaldehyde. Placing these plants in rooms with new furniture or heavy carpentry, particularly in areas with limited ventilation, provides a low-cost, aesthetically pleasing supplement to other reduction strategies. While plants alone are not a substitute for proper ventilation or air purifiers, they contribute meaningfully to improving overall indoor air quality.
6. Keep Your Home Clean
Dust and particulate matter can adsorb formaldehyde molecules, allowing them to settle onto surfaces and be re-released later. Regular cleaning, including vacuuming upholstery, carpets, and curtains, reduces the reservoir of formaldehyde-laden particles in your home. Using mild, eco-friendly cleaning products also matters, as some commercial cleaners contain VOCs themselves and can add to your indoor chemical load rather than reduce it.
